Typical Issues with Doors and Windows
Understanding the typical concerns that house owners face is the initial step towards effective repairs. Here are some frequent problems:
DoorsMisalignment: A door that does not hang appropriately might not close or lock effectively.Warping: Wooden doors can warp due to humidity, triggering gaps or troubles in closing.Fractures: Physical damage from harsh weather or effect can result in cracks in a door's surface area.Broken hardware: Hinges, locks, and manages might break over time or end up being harmed.WindowsDrafts: Air leakages can take place due to used seals or shifting frames, causing energy inefficiency.Cloudy Glass: This is typically the outcome of condensation between double-glazed panes.Missing Out On or Damaged Caulking: Weatherproofing can wear, allowing water and air seepage.Faulty Locks: Locks may break or end up being loose, compromising security.Important Tools for DIY Repairs
For property owners who prefer to take on repairs themselves, having the right tools is essential. Here's a list of important tools required for door and window repairs:
Screwdrivers: Phillips and flat-head varieties for installing and getting rid of hardware.Hammer: Useful for driving in nails or adjusting misaligned doors.Pry Bar: Helps in removing frames when necessary.Level: Ensures that windows and doors are installed appropriately without misalignment.Utility Knife: For cutting caulking or trimming materials.Sculpt: For changing door frames or hardware fittings.Tape Measure: Essential for accurate measurements.Caulking Gun: Necessary for using brand-new weatherproofing products.Step-by-Step Repair TechniquesRepairing a Misaligned DoorDetermine the Issue: Check the alignment by closing the door and looking for spaces.Adjust the Hinges: Tighten or loosen hinge screws to move the door into the desired position.Check the Fit: Close the door to see if the modifications repaired the problem. Repeat if required.Fixing a Drafty WindowInspect the Seals: Look for spaces around the window frame.Eliminate Old Caulk: Use an utility knife to cut away harmed caulk.Clean the Surface: Wipe away debris to guarantee a strong bond.Apply New Caulking: Use a caulking weapon to complete spaces evenly.Test for Drafts: Check for any staying air leak by feeling for drafts with your hands.Attending To Cloudy Double-Glazed WindowsExamine the Damage: Determine if the window can be repaired or if it requires replacing.Contact Professionals: If the condensation suggests a broken seal, seek advice from a window specialist for replacement.Preventive Maintenance Tips
Preventive maintenance can conserve property owners time and money on repairs. Here are some techniques to keep doors and windows in top condition:
Regular inspections: Check for indications of wear and damage at least two times a year.Clean surface areas: Regularly clean door and window frames to prevent buildup of dirt and grime.Change weather stripping: Annually check and change any weather condition stripping that shows signs of wear.Lubricate Hardware: Periodically oil hinges and locks to guarantee smooth operation.Paint or seal wood: Protect wood windows and doors by using paint or sealant as required.When to Seek Professional Help
While many property owners can carry out small repairs themselves, certain situations are best addressed by experts. Situations may consist of:
Extensive damage requiring replacement of whole doors or windows.Complex problems involving structural integrity.Repairs that involve electrical parts, such as automated door systems.Lack of time or experience in undertaking repairs.

FAQs
1. How often must I check my doors and windows?It is suggested to examine your doors and windows at least two times a year, ideally throughout the spring and fall seasons. 2. Can I repair a deformed door myself?In some cases,
you can repair a warped door by adjusting the hinges or using heat to improve it. Nevertheless, substantial warping might need professional intervention. 3. How do I understand if my window needs replacing?If you notice extensive fogging in between panes

, relentless drafts in spite of sealing efforts, or considerable physical damage, it might be time to change the window. 4. What kind of caulk is best for window repairs?Silicone-based caulk is normally chosen for windows due to its versatility and durability, specifically in
outside applications. 5. Is it worth replacing a broken lock myself?Replacing a broken Lock Repair is typically a simple task. However, if you're uncertain about the security it provides, consider hiring a locksmith professional for

best outcomes. By keeping your doors and windows in optimum condition, you can safeguard your home and boost its overall value and livability.
